After much digging, I finally found an example of the terms and conditions of an automobile lease. The automobile manufacturers do everything possible to keep the actual details from being seen until it’s time to sign the contract. True, basic terms (like 0% APR, $1000 customer loyalty cash, etc.) are laid out because they are incentives to buy. But these teasers are always followed by something along the lines of “See dealer for full details.” But now you can read on to see full details….

Due to major security breaches recently, Sony is providing a year of free identity protection via Debix’s AllClear ID system for qualifying PSN users. Anyone signing up for this service is subject to AllClear ID’s End User Services Agreement. Since more than 70 million people are affected by this situation, this seemed like a good contract to review for this week.
